Dr. Lluis Batet Miracle is a Professor at the Universitat Politècnica de Catalunya (UPC) with the Department of Physics . He leads the Advanced Nuclear Technologies Research Group (ANT) and has contributed extensively to nuclear fusion technology, thermal hydraulics, and liquid metal systems. His work spans reactor safety analysis, tritium processing, and magnetohydrodynamic modeling. Expertise : Nuclear Engineering, Plasma Physics, Computational Fluid Dynamics, Fusion Reactor Design, Tritium Management Notable Projects : CONSOLIDER TECNO-FUS (2009-2013), EURATOM collaborations, HCLL Breeding Blanket Systems for ITER Research Trends : Recent publications focus on helium solubility in liquid metals, bubble dynamics in fusion blankets, and MHD simulations under nuclear conditions. His work combines atomistic modeling, high-fidelity CFD, and experimental validation for tritium and hydrogen systems in fusion reactors.
